I was very pleased when we signed Pedro. He was a player I always rated highly and I had high hopes that Pedro and Hazard would give us a little of what we had when we have Duff and Robben. 

 

No doubt he has failed to live up to his price tag this season however nor have just about every one else in the team and he has had the additional burden that others haven't had of adjusting to a new league.

 

I am of the view that writing him off now would be too hasty.  I'd like to see him stay and try and prove himself next season, hopefully with a higher performing team and a little l4ess turmoil in the squad.
